Longing for Love: A Heartfelt Reggaeton Ballad
Zion & Lennox's "Tengo Que Decir" is a poignant reggaeton ballad that delves into the depths of longing and heartache. The song's lyrics express the profound emptiness and dissatisfaction the narrator feels when separated from their loved one. The recurring theme of missing the presence of a partner in bed highlights the intimacy and connection that is sorely missed. This longing is not just physical but emotional, as the narrator yearns for the comfort and warmth that their partner brings.
The song is rich with metaphors and vivid imagery, painting a picture of a love that transcends physical boundaries. The lyrics speak of a desire to travel the world and overcome any obstacle to be reunited with the beloved. This sense of urgency and determination underscores the depth of the narrator's feelings. The mention of "breakfast love" and "being alone" further emphasizes the desire for shared moments and the pain of solitude.
Zion & Lennox, known for their romantic reggaeton style, infuse the song with a blend of passion and vulnerability. Their music often explores themes of love, desire, and relationships, resonating with listeners who have experienced similar emotions. "Tengo Que Decir" is a testament to the power of love and the lengths one is willing to go to reclaim it. The song's emotional depth and catchy rhythm make it a standout track in their discography, capturing the essence of longing and the hope for reconciliation.
